Asking for an update - I am interested in a SIG 320 RX model - do we have an update on the reliability of the SIG 320 RX combo with emphasis on the optic? (Please, not asking about "drop" issue, etc.).
There is a new style of the current Romeo1 that extends the existing hood slightly to ensure the lens isn't exposed. That has been shipping since fall.
AddRomeo1 to that the Romeo1 Shroud that the Romeo1 fits into and the whole unit is tightened down using the existing bolts. I have seen that's shroud up for preorder at Optics Planet.
There is also a Romeo1T (for Tactical) that has a more durable aluminum shroud from the factory. The dot may also be brighter with a longer battery life according to Shot Show videos. I also heard something about a new Romeo1 with a DP footprint. Not sure if that is the R1T. I'll try to get some confirmation.
